Frequently asked questions about Qamar Foundation

What does Qamar Foundation do?

We provide emergency response, care for vulnerable children, support education, ensure access to essential resources like healthcare and clean water, and promote sustainable livelihoods for better lives and communities.

How much income did Qamar Foundation report in 2024?

Qamar Foundation reported total income of £1.29m and reported expenditure of £1.31m for the financial year ending 2024, based on the most recent annual return filed with the Charity Commission.

When was Qamar Foundation registered as a charity?

Qamar Foundation was registered with the Charity Commission for England and Wales on 12 December 2012 as charity number 1150141. It has been registered for 14 years.

Who runs Qamar Foundation?

Qamar Foundation is governed by a board of 3 trustees. The chair of trustees is MIRWAIS KHAN. Trustees are legally responsible for the charity's governance and are listed in full on its profile.

Where does Qamar Foundation operate?

Qamar Foundation operates across 2 areas: Afghanistan and Pakistan.

Is Qamar Foundation a registered charity?

Yes — Qamar Foundation is a registered charity in England and Wales, charity number 1150141.
